ZZ Top has been rocking Texas since the 1960s. Shows as good as theirs don’t come around like this very often, and soon never again. The Raw Whisky Tour will be the final ride for the Rock & Roll Hall of Famers. You can experience the show for yourself in Belton at the Bell County Expo.

To this day their 1973 hit La Grange is a goto karaoke favorite. As you get older, your list of missed opportunities seems to grow because you just never know when something will happen for its final time. The Raw Whisky Tour is the FINAL time to see ZZ Top in Central Texas.

Legacy acts are something truly special to enjoy. Elvis left the building for the final time 45 years ago, and if he were alive today he still wouldn’t be 90. Willie Nelson turns 90 in April, the same month ZZ Top rides through for one last rodeo. Sadly, Dusty Hill has passed, but this is your chance to see 2 of the 3 members of a band that was inducted into the Rock & Roll Hall of Fame by a Rolling Stone.
